How do you convert 150g flour to Cups?
- 125g All-Purpose Flour = 1 cup
- 137g Bread Flour = 1 cup
- 120g Whole Wheat Flour = 1 cup

When was the imperial cup used?
UK imperial cup was used in pre-1970 recipes. Sometimes the metric cup (250 mL) is still used in the UK, Australia, New Zealand, Canada and South Africa. In our grams to cups calculator you can choose between the first three cup types.
How many grams are in a cup of water?
For example, if you want to convert 1 standard US cup of water into grams, you get exactly 236.59 g . However, 1 cup of salt weights around 287 g and 1 cup of wheat flour - only 141.6 g.
What is a legal cup?
There is also another cup type in the USA, and it's called a legal cup. It is used in nutrition labeling, and it measures 240 mL. Notes on ingredient measurements
It is a bit tricky to get an accurate food conversion since its characteristics change according to humidity, temperature, or how well packed the ingredient is. Ingredients that contain the terms sliced, minced, diced, crushed, chopped add uncertainties to the measurements.
